STOCK AND UNIT PURCHASE AGREEMENT

THIS STOCK AND UNIT PURCHASE AGREEMENT (this “Agreement”) is entered into as of November 10, 2021 by and among Definitive Healthcare Corp., a Delaware corporation (the “Company”), and certain persons listed on Schedule I hereto (each such securityholder a “Seller” and collectively, the “Sellers”).

BACKGROUND

A. The Company has determined to effect an underwritten public offering (the “Offering”) of shares of the Company’s Class A Common Stock $0.001 par value per share (the “Class A Common Stock”).

B. The Sellers intend to sell to the Company, and the Company intends to purchase from the Sellers, in a private, non-underwritten transaction, a portion of the shares of Class A Common Stock and/or limited liability company units (“LLC Units”) of AIDH TopCo, LLC (“Definitive OpCo”) held by the Sellers, as applicable, as set forth herein (the “Firm Purchased Equity Interests), at the price and upon the terms and conditions provided in this Agreement.

C. In order to effect the Offering, the Company and Definitive OpCo will enter into an Underwriting Agreement (the “Underwriting Agreement”) with Goldman Sachs & Co. LLC, J.P. Morgan Securities LLC, Morgan Stanley & Co. LLC and Barclays Capital Inc., as representatives of the several underwriters named therein (the “Underwriters”), and the Underwriters will have the option to purchase, at one or more times, additional shares of Class A Common Stock in the aggregate in the Offering pursuant to the Underwriting Agreement (each, an “Over-Allotment Option”).

D. In connection with each exercise of an Over-Allotment Option by the Underwriters, each Seller will sell to the Company an additional number of shares of Class A Common Stock and LLC Units, as applicable (the “Option Purchased Equity Interests,” and together with the Firm Purchased Equity Interests, the “Purchased Equity Interests”), at the price and upon the terms and conditions provided in this Agreement.

E. The Company and the Sellers agree that the transactions contemplated by this Agreement are being undertaken to reduce each Seller’s interest in the Company after the Offering.

AGREEMENT

1. Purchase of Company and Definitive OpCo Equity Interests.

(a) The per share or unit purchase price, as applicable, for each Firm Purchased Equity Interest to be purchased by the Company pursuant to Section 1(b) shall be equal to the price at which each share of Class A Common Stock is purchased from the Company by the Underwriters pursuant to the Underwriting Agreement and the per share or unit purchase price, as applicable, for each Option Purchased Equity Interest to be purchased by the Company pursuant to Section 1(c) shall be equal to the price at which each share of Class A Common Stock is purchased from the Company by the Underwriters pursuant to the Underwriting Agreement (the “Per Equity Interest Purchase Price”).


(b) At the Initial Closing (as defined below) and subject to the satisfaction of the terms and conditions set forth herein, each Seller hereby agrees to sell, and the Company hereby agrees to purchase from each of them, at the Per Equity Interest Purchase Price the number of shares of Class A Common Stock or LLC Units (rounded to the nearest whole number), as applicable, equal to the number calculated by multiplying (i) the total number of shares of Class A Common Stock and LLC Units to be purchased by the Company from existing holders of shares of Class A common stock or LLC Units, if any, as specified in the Prospectus filed by the Company pursuant to Rule 424(b) in connection with the Offering (the “Prospectus”), without giving effect to the exercise of the Over-Allotment Option, by (ii) the Seller’s Pro Rata Percentage of Proceeds as set forth opposite such Seller’s name on Schedule I hereto. The aggregate number of shares of Class A Common Stock or LLC Units to be purchased from the Sellers, if any, and disclosed in the Prospectus will be determined by the Company in its sole discretion. For the avoidance of doubt, if the Company determines it will not use any of the proceeds of the Offering to purchase shares of Class A Common Stock or LLC Units from existing holders, it will notify the Sellers of such determination and the Company will have no obligation to use any of the proceeds from the Offering to purchase any shares of Class A Common Stock or LLC Units from the Sellers hereunder.

(c) Unless the Company has notified the Sellers of its determination to not use any of the proceeds from the Offering to purchase shares of Class A Common Stock or LLC Units from the Sellers as set forth in Section 1(b), if the Underwriters exercise an Over-Allotment Option, at an Option Closing (as defined below) and subject to the satisfaction of the terms and conditions set forth herein, each Seller shall sell, and the Company shall purchase from each of them at the Per Equity Interest Purchase Price, an additional number of shares of Class A Common Stock or LLC Units (rounded to the nearest whole number), as applicable, equal to (i) the aggregate proceeds the Company receives from the Underwriters pursuant to such Over-Allotment Option divided by the Per Equity Interest Purchase Price multiplied by (ii) such Seller’s Pro Rata Percentage of Over-Allotment Proceeds as set forth opposite such Seller’s name on Schedule I hereto. For the avoidance of doubt, any Option Purchased Equity Interests to be purchased pursuant to this Agreement as a result of an Over-Allotment Option shall constitute Purchased Equity Interests for all purposes under this Agreement.

(d) In connection with any purchase of LLC Units by the Company pursuant to this Agreement, the corresponding shares of Class B Common Stock of the Company shall be retired and canceled for no consideration.

(i) The closing of the transactions contemplated by Section 1(b) (the “Initial Closing”) shall occur immediately after the closing of the Offering, or at such other time or place after the Offering as may be agreed upon by the Company and the Sellers. At the Initial Closing, the Sellers shall deliver to the Company customary duly executed stock powers or other transfer instruments relating to the applicable Initial Purchased Equity Interests, and the Company agrees to deliver to the Sellers an aggregate dollar amount equal to the product of the Per Equity Interest Purchase Price and the total number of applicable Initial Purchased Equity Interests by wire transfer of immediately available funds pursuant to the wire transfer instructions set forth opposite such Seller’s name on Schedule II hereto.

 

3


(j) The closing of any transactions contemplated by Section 1(c), which for the avoidance of doubt may be at the same time as the Initial Closing (a “Option Closing”) shall occur as promptly as practicable following the Company’s receipt of proceeds from the Underwriters pursuant to such Over-Allotment Option, or at such other time or place as may be agreed upon by the Company and the Sellers. At such Option Closing, the Sellers shall deliver to the Company customary duly executed stock powers or other transfer instruments relating to the applicable Option Purchased Equity Interests, and the Company agrees to deliver to the Sellers an aggregate dollar amount equal to the product of the Per Equity Interest Purchase Price and the total number of applicable Option Purchased Equity Interests by wire transfer of immediately available funds pursuant to the wire transfer instructions set forth opposite such Seller’s name on Schedule II hereto.

(k) Notwithstanding any other provision in this Agreement, the Company and its agents and affiliates shall have the right to deduct and withhold taxes from any payments to be made to any Seller pursuant to this Agreement if, in their opinion, such withholding is required by law, and shall be provided with any necessary tax forms, including Form W-9 or the appropriate series of Form W-8, as applicable, and any similar information. To the extent that any of the aforementioned amounts are so withheld, such withheld amounts shall be treated for all purposes of this Agreement as having been delivered and paid to the recipient of the payments in respect of which such deduction and withholding was made. To the extent that any payment pursuant to this Agreement is not reduced by any such required deduction or withholding, the Company may deduct and withhold with respect to any future payment to such person to cover such amounts. The Company and Sellers agree to cooperate in good faith to reduce or eliminate any applicable withholding tax.

6. Miscellaneous.

(a) Survival of Representations and Warranties. All representations and warranties contained herein or made in writing by any party in connection herewith shall survive the execution and delivery of this Agreement and the consummation of the transactions contemplated hereby.

(b) Severability. If any term or other provision of this Agreement shall be held invalid, illegal or unenforceable, the validity, legality or enforceability of the other provisions of this Agreement shall not be affected thereby, and there shall be deemed substituted for the provision at issue a valid, legal and enforceable provision as similar as possible to the provision at issue.

 

6


(c) No Prior Agreement. This Agreement supersedes all prior agreements and understandings (whether written or oral) among the parties hereto with respect to the subject matter hereof.

(d) Counterparts. This Agreement may be executed in separate counterparts, each of which is deemed to be an original and all of which taken together constitute one and the same agreement. The words “execution,” “signed,” “signature,” “delivery,” and words of like import in or relating to this Agreement or any document to be signed in connection with this Agreement shall be deemed to include electronic signatures, deliveries or the keeping of records in electronic form, each of which shall be of the same legal effect, validity or enforceability as a manually executed signature, physical delivery thereof or the use of a paper-based recordkeeping system, as the case may be, and the parties hereto consent to conduct the transactions contemplated hereunder by electronic means.

(e) Successors and Assigns. Neither this Agreement nor any of the rights, interests or obligations hereunder shall be assigned, in whole or in part, by any of the parties without the prior written consent of the other parties. This Agreement shall be binding upon and inure solely to the benefit of the Sellers and the Company and their respective successors and permitted assigns, and no other person shall acquire or have any right under or by virtue of this Agreement.

(f) No Third Party Beneficiaries or Other Rights. This Agreement is for the sole benefit of the parties hereto and their successors and permitted assigns and nothing herein express or implied shall give or shall be construed to confer any legal or equitable rights or remedies to any person other than the parties to this Agreement and such successors and permitted assigns.

(g) Governing Law; Jurisdiction. THIS AGREEMENT AND ANY MATTERS RELATED TO THIS TRANSACTION SHALL BE GOVERNED BY AND CONSTRUED IN ACCORDANCE WITH THE LAWS OF THE STATE OF DELAWARE WITHOUT REGARD TO PRINCIPLES OF CONFLICT OF LAWS THAT WOULD RESULT IN THE APPLICATION OF ANY LAW OTHER THAN THE LAWS OF THE STATE OF DELAWARE. EACH OF THE PARTIES TO THIS AGREEMENT IRREVOCABLY WAIVES, TO THE FULLEST EXTENT PERMITTED BY APPLICABLE LAW, ANY AND ALL RIGHTS TO TRIAL BY JURY IN ANY LEGAL PROCEEDING ARISING OUT OF OR RELATED TO THIS AGREEMENT OR THE TRANSACTIONS CONTEMPLATED HEREBY. Each of the parties to this Agreement (i) irrevocably submits to the personal jurisdiction of any state or federal court sitting in Wilmington, Delaware, as well as to the jurisdiction of all courts to which an appeal may be taken from such courts, in any suit, action or proceeding relating to or arising out of, under or in connection with this Agreement, (ii) agrees that all claims in respect of such suit, action or proceeding, whether arising under contract, tort or otherwise, shall be brought, heard and determined exclusively in the Delaware Court of Chancery (provided that, in the event that subject matter jurisdiction is unavailable in that court, then all such claims shall be brought, heard and determined exclusively in any other state or federal court sitting in Wilmington, Delaware), (iii) agrees that it shall not attempt to deny or defeat such personal jurisdiction by motion or other request for leave from such court, and (iv) agrees not to bring any action or proceeding relating to or arising out of, under or in connection with this Agreement in any other court, tribunal, forum or proceeding. Each of the parties to this Agreement waives any defense of inconvenient forum to the maintenance of any action or proceeding brought in accordance with this paragraph. Each of

 

7


the parties to this Agreement agrees that service of any process, summons, notice or document by U.S. registered mail to its address set forth herein shall be effective service of process for any action, suit or proceeding brought against it in accordance with this paragraph, provided that nothing in the foregoing sentence shall affect the right of any party to serve legal process in any other manner permitted by law.

(h) Remedies. The parties hereto agree and acknowledge that money damages would not be an adequate remedy for any breach of the provisions of this Agreement, that any breach of the provisions of this Agreement shall cause the other parties irreparable harm, and that any party may in its sole discretion apply to any court of law or equity of competent jurisdiction (without posting any bond or deposit) for specific performance or other injunctive relief in order to enforce, or prevent any violations of, the provisions of this Agreement.

(i) Amendment and Waiver. The provisions of this Agreement may be amended or waived at any time only by the written agreement of the Sellers and the Company. Any waiver, permit, consent or approval of any kind or character on the part of any such holders of any provision or condition of this Agreement must be made in writing and shall be effective only to the extent specifically set forth in writing. The failure of any party hereto to enforce at any time any provision of this Agreement shall not be construed to be a waiver of such provision, nor in any way to affect the validity of this Agreement or any part hereof or the right of any party thereafter to enforce each and every such provision. No waiver of any breach of this Agreement shall be held to constitute a waiver of any other or subsequent breach.

(j) Further Assurances. Each of the Company and the Sellers shall execute and deliver such additional documents and instruments and shall take such further action as may be necessary or appropriate to effectuate fully the provisions of this Agreement.

(k) Mutuality of Drafting. The parties have participated jointly in the negotiation and drafting of this Agreement. In the event an ambiguity or question of intent or interpretation arises, this Agreement shall be construed as jointly drafted by the parties, and no presumption or burden of proof shall arise favoring or disfavoring any party by virtue of the authorship of any provision of this Agreement.
